Action item: The Relayn deploy-status bot silently dropped updates when the pipeline API paginated results, so responders believed a rollback had completed when it had not. We will add pagination handling, a staleness banner, and an integration test. Until merged, verify deploy state directly in the pipeline console, documented at the page below.

runbook for kahop-kajop: https://rundeck.ordinio.test/display/secrets/pipeline/issue/pages/repo/browse/e5732776e07d1285107e5aeb

The Marlowe Address Autocomplete widget returns up to five suggestions per keystroke, scoped to the regions configured in the tenant dashboard. Rate limits apply per session, not per user. Support agents reproducing customer issues should query the sandbox endpoint directly, authenticating with the bearer token that appears below.

session JWT of yawep-yawep = eyJhbGciOiJIUzI1NiIsInR5cCI6IkpXVCJ9.eyJzdWIiOiI3pWF3_In0.aXYsHiog

Hey Mira — handing off SurveyTrek offline mode before I'm out. Sync queue now persists to local storage, so field crews near Dunmore Ridge won't lose entries. If a device gets wiped mid-survey, restore from the encrypted bundle in settings. Support will need the recovery passphrase, which is:

vault phrase of tajef-tafog = istox-sorax-zorox-casok-holox-kelix-weneth-drueth-casion

## Authentication

Hey on-call friend — if Glacierbox starts complaining while archiving cold storage buckets, it's almost always auth. The archiver sweeps buckets older than 180 days into the frostvault tier every night around 02:00, and it needs a valid key for the Permafrost API to do the move. Tokens from the old Icehouse flow won't work anymore; we killed that path in the last cleanup. Don't mint your own key with the CLI — use the shared one. It's right here:

API key for yahig-tadup: kto7_ubizbYm